Abstract
Hydroxo-bridged dimers of [(acacen)CrOH]2 (acacen = N,N′-bis(t-butylacetylacetone)-1,2-ethylenediimine) and [(salen)CrOH]2 have been isolated from hydrolysis of the corresponding (acacen)CrCl and (salen)CrOMe derivatives. Structural studies reveal the octahedral coordination around the chromium centers to be distorted. The (acacen)CrCl complex in the presence of cocatalysts PCy3 or [PPN][Cl] is an effective catalyst for the production of polycarbonate from cyclohexene oxide and carbon dioxide, albeit less so than its salen analog.
